London's Bridges map out the route of the Thames. Westminster Bridge is a particularly fine example. This view from the Terrace of the Houses of Parliament shows the London Eye towering over the River Thames. Watchful, like the Eye of Sauron, but with a much friendlier effect.
The picture is painted on watercolour paper. I create a pencil image and then go over all the lines with masking fluid before painting it with a watercolour wash which gets covered with clingfilm. Once this is removed the picture is further developed using acrylic inks which are left to dry before the masking is removed to reveal the final picture.
